3. COMPOSITION/INFORMATION ON INGREDIENTS:
FPA Control I (High): Freeze dried powder contains FPA (<50ng desiccated), glycine (<20mg),
sodium chloride (<10mg), bovine serum albumine (< 10mg), ciprofloxacine (<0.001%).
FPA Control II (Low): Freeze dried powder contains FPA (<50ng desiccated), glycine (<20mg),
sodium chloride (<10mg), bovine serum albumine (< 10mg), ciprofloxacine (<0.001%).

5. HEALTH HAZARDS DATA:
All the above listed chemicals or biologicals may be harmful by inhalation, ingestion, or skin
adsorption. Nasal irritation, eye reddening, and allergic reactions may result from overexposure.
First aid: - If swallowed, wash out mouth with water provided person is conscious.
Medical advice is necessary.
- In case of contact with eyes, flush with copious amounts of water, for at
least 15 minutes. Assure adequate flushing by separating the eyelids with
fingers.
- In case of inhalation, remove victim to fresh air, and seek medical advice.
- In any case of overexposure, call a physician.
Viral Safety: - BSA was prepared from bovine plasma; which was tested for the absence
of infectious agents, and collected from animals free from BSE. However, no
test may totally exclude the absence of infectious agents. As any product of
bovine origin, this reagent must be used with all the cautions required for
handling a material potentially infectious.
6. FIRE AND EXPLOSION HAZARD DATA:
Flammability: Restored reagents are aqueous and non-flammable. Only carton boxes, dry
chemical, interiors inserts are flammable.
Extinguishing Media: Carbon dioxide, dry chemical powder or appropriate foam.
Special fire fighting procedures: Wear self-contained breathing apparatus and protective clothing
to prevent contact with skin.

7. REACTIVITY DATA:
Stability: Stable
Hazardous combustion or decomposition products: Carbon monoxide, carbon dioxide, nitrogen
oxide.
Hazardous polymerisation: Does not occur.
8. SPILL, LEAK AND DISPOSAL PROCEDURES:
Steps to be taken if material is released or spilled:
- Sweep up, place in a bag and hold for waste material. Avoid raising dust. Ventilate area and
wash spill site after material pickup is complete.
- Waste disposal method:
Comply with all federal, state and local environmental regulations on waste handling and
disposal.

14. TRANSPORT AND STORAGE INFORMATION:
The kit must be shipped adequately packaged and protected from any break during
transportation.
It can be shipped at ambient temperature for a short period, not exceeding 7 days. It must be
stored in a cold room at 2-8掳C upon receipt.
No special regulation for transporting this product.
General rules for in vitro research use should apply.
Local, State and Federal regulations for this kind of product must be respected.
The kit must be stored in an appropriate refrigerated area, specifically dedicated for in vitro
research kits.
All the storage constraints are indicated on the package labels and on the kit insert.
